AGA Cookers

An electric AGA uses an ingenious thermostatically-controlled warm-air re-circulation system to maintain the cooker's perfect operating temperature. In AGA's best tradition, it uses simple, well-proven and highly reliable technology to achieve this feat of engineering.

The electric AGA operates on a normal household 13A supply (all other electric cookers require at least 30A), which means that the overall running costs can be much the same as any other type of AGA. And, as it is always on, its is always ready to use with no time wasted for the cooker to heat up to temperature.

Because it's electric, there's no need for a flue or chimney as there's no gas or oil to burn. This means greater flexibility on positioning the cooker in your kitchen - i.e. not on external wall, just near a 13A socket.
